We were originally booked into the Beauchamp but a few days prior were moved to their sister hotel next door called the Portland. We were very disappointed to see the difference in accommodation compared to the photos of the Beauchamp we had booked - the Portland is extremely dated and not modern looking like the other. After a long day in London and late evening being spent at BST Hyde Park, this was disappointing to arrive to. Not only this - the hotel corridors are so narrow it is like a marble run trying to navigate your way round, When we arrived to our room, it was extremely hot to the point of sweating - we had to instantly open all windows and luckily found two big fans in the cupboard which we had to leave on all night. Also, although a quad was booked and in the photos this shows two double beds - we arrived to one double bed and a pull out sofa bed with a paper thin mattress - my poor daughter barely slept do to being uncomfortable and it feeling like she was being poked in the back. This being said - the reception staff were always lovely, polite and very attentive. We were offered free breakfast which we went to the Beauchamp to have and on walking in we could definitely see it was more modern - and the cooked breakfast was actually lovely, staff were very nice and service was quick. One request would be to have the offer of a latte/cappuccino etc. rather than just your standard tea and filter coffee. So to sum it up - don't book the Portland over the two :)

Property Description

  • Opened: 2008
  • Number of Rooms: 47
With a stay at Grange Beauchamp, you'll be centrally located in London, steps from Russell Square and 5 minutes by foot from The British Museum. This upscale hotel is 0.8 mi (1.3 km) from Covent Garden Market and 0.3 mi (0.4 km) from University College London.

Make use of convenient am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and babysitting (surcharge).

Satisfy your appetite for lunch or dinner at The Beauchamp, a restaurant which specializes in international cuisine, or stay in and take advantage of the 24-hour room service.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. Continental breakfasts are available daily for a fee.

Featured amenities include complimentary wired internet access, a business center, and limo/town car service. This hotel has 4 meeting rooms available for events.

Stay in one of 47 guestrooms featuring LCD televisions. Complimentary wired and w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ming provides ent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include safes and desks, as well as phones with free local calls.
